Since 1800, the Dana Meeting House Has Stood the Test of Time. With Your Help, It Will Stand for Centuries More.

The Dana Meeting House is one of New Hampshire's treasured historic landmarks—a place where history, community, and tradition continue to come together more than 225 years after its founding.

Today, we are seeking support for several important preservation projects that will help protect this remarkable building and improve access for future generations.

Our Preservation Priorities

Immediate Priority: Window Restoration

  • Repair and restore historic windowsills sills and frames to protect the building and preserve its character.

Future Site Improvements

  • Grade and level the grounds to improve parking, drainage, accessibility, and visitor safety.
  • Rebuild the accessibility ramp with a design that better reflects the Meeting House's historic architecture.
  • Reconstruct the outhouse and storage shed in keeping with the appearance and craftsmanship of the early 1800s.
